Mexico is in a no win situation, they are bleeding money from selling fuel too cheap but when they try to do something about it, like cutting off greedy gringos from their dirt cheap diesel, they risk offending all US travelers that don't just buy fuel but food, gifts, medicine, dental work, ect... If they raise the price just a little, the poor (and there are a lot of poor in Mexico) will fill the streets in protest. Getting around is just as important to them and fuel costs takes a much bigger bite out of their pockets.

Sundays Trip to TJ for fuel

I was down there today (37min round trip)

I went to the station in la mesa (about 5 miles east) or tj

The guy pointed me to a sign (i took a photo and will post later)

not sure what it says

I will have it translated.

but he pointed to it when I pointed to my Aux tank.



Only factory installed tanks now will they fill.

and from what i have herd also Mexican Customs is on the prowl for people that have Mex diesel in non factory tanks.
